‘Ctrl’ Netflix Review: An Ambitious Cyber-Thriller That’s Definitely Worth Your Time

I’ve watched my fair share of cyberhorror films and, for the most part, enjoyed them for their newness and zeal. Vikramaditya Motwane’s Ctrl is certainly an ambitious film. There’s no denying that it’s got something that urges you as a viewer to keep watching. Ctrl tells the story of Nella Awasthi and her boyfriend Joe, who’ve become famous thanks to their relationship being a tool for their income. The perfect life of this seemingly impeccable couple is shattered when Nella tries to surprise Joe for their 5th anniversary and instead finds him kissing another girl. Nella immediately shuts Joe out. However, wild things start happening when Nella installs a new app to erase his memory from her life forever.
